XOPS (a collective term for operations practices like DevOps, MLOps, AIOps, and DataOps) can significantly enhance customer experience through the following mechanisms:

1. Faster Delivery of Features and Fixes
- Agile Iterations: XOPS aligns with agile principles, enabling rapid development and deployment of new features based on customer feedback.
- Continuous Delivery: Automated CI/CD pipelines ensure that updates and fixes reach customers faster, reducing downtime and improving satisfaction.
2. Personalized Experiences
- Data-Driven Insights: MLOps and DataOps enable real-time analytics, providing businesses with insights into customer behavior to offer personalized experiences.
- AI-Powered Recommendations: AIOps integrates machine learning models to power recommendation engines, chatbots, and tailored content.
3. Improved Reliability and Performance
- Proactive Monitoring: AIOps leverages predictive analytics to identify and resolve potential issues before they affect customers.
- Enhanced Uptime: Automated monitoring and self-healing systems ensure services are always available, improving trust and reliability.
4. Seamless Multichannel Experiences
- Integrated Systems: XOPS practices streamline integrations across platforms, ensuring a consistent user experience across web, mobile, and other channels.
- Automated Workflows: Smooth transitions between services and systems reduce friction in the customer journey.
5. Enhanced Customer Support
- AI-Driven Support: AIOps enables intelligent virtual assistants and automated ticket resolution to provide quicker support.
- Faster Escalation: Automated alerting and incident response ensure customer complaints are resolved efficiently.
6. Continuous Improvement Through Feedback Loops
- Real-Time Feedback Analysis: With MLOps, customer feedback can be analyzed in real-time to prioritize feature development or issue resolution.
- Adaptive Systems: Automated learning systems adjust to customer needs dynamically, ensuring relevance and satisfaction.
7. Cost Efficiency Passed to Customers
- Optimized Resource Use: XOPS reduces operational costs through automation and efficiency, allowing businesses to offer better pricing or invest in customer experience.
